The annual Migration Festival took place at the Lighthouse Point Park in New
Haven this past Sunday. Gary Lemmon and I spent the day hosting visitors in
our CBA Butterfly Garden. 

The day was cool and overcast, warming a bit in the early afternoon. Many
old and new friends visited, some lingering for hours. Monarchs flew in one
to three at a time throughout the day. The garden was alive with children of
all ages chasing and netting them. 

We tagged 85 and another visitor tagged 14 with her own tags. 

Many membership brochures were distributed, and at least one person joined
on the spot. 

Other species caught, boxed and observed, or seen on the wing: common
buckeye (2), American lady (2), sachem (~5), fiery skipper (~5), cabbage
white (~10), clouded sulphur (~3). 

It was a great way to celebrate the end of another season of field trips.
